TransMedics is revolutionizing organ transportation with its FDA-approved Organ Care System, improving organ functionality during transport. Significant investments in logistics, including owning aircraft, enhancing its moat, reducing graft dysfunction by 50% and improving donation effectiveness. The company has a strong competitive edge, evident in its 100%+ YoY sales growth and 10-12% net margins, yet trades at a lower EV/Sales multiple than peers.
